What is Shadow IT? +

Shadow IT refers to unauthorized or unregistered external emails (like a freelancer's personal @gmail.com) that employees share company files with, bypassing official IT oversight.

What is an Orphaned Asset? +

An orphaned asset is an externally shared file owned by an employee who has since been offboarded. These files often remain accessible to external parties indefinitely if not properly audited.

Do you ever scan the contents of my files? +

Never. Drive-Guard utilizes the `drive.metadata.readonly` permission scope. We mathematically cannot read the actual contents (text, images, data) of your files.

What is a Zero-Knowledge Architecture? +

It means our remote servers literally have zero knowledge of your data. We do not store, process, or transmit your Google Drive files or collaborator lists.

Where is my data stored? +

Your data is stored exclusively in your local browser's memory (localStorage and IndexedDB). It never leaves your device.

What happens if Drive-Guard gets hacked? +

Because we do not possess your data or API tokens on our backend servers, a breach of our infrastructure cannot result in a breach of your Google Workspace data.

How does the Bring-Your-Own-App (BYOA) model protect me? +

You generate a private API key within your own Google Cloud console. You own the project, meaning you retain the ultimate kill-switch. You can revoke access instantly from your Google Admin console.

Google Workspace Integration

What Google Workspace permissions does Drive-Guard need? +

Drive-Guard requires `drive.metadata.readonly` to scan permissions and `drive.file` to execute revocations. It does not require full drive access.

What if I am a corporate employee and cannot generate a Google Cloud API Key? +

Use the 'Forward to IT Admin' button in the setup wizard to securely request an Internal Client ID from your IT team.

Can Drive-Guard detect external access on folders I don't own? +

Drive-Guard can scan any folder or file that your authenticated Google Workspace account has at least 'Viewer' permissions for.

How long does a full security scan take? +

A typical Google Drive containing 10,000 files usually takes less than 45 seconds to fully parse and map into your security dashboard.

What happens when a Time-to-Live (TTL) timer expires? +

Drive-Guard issues an API command directly to Google Workspace to instantly purge the vendor's email address from all shared folders, leaving internal access fully intact.

What if I accidentally revoke someone's access by mistake? +

Because Drive-Guard integrates natively, you can easily go into Google Drive and re-share the folder. We also maintain a local SOC Audit Trail of every revocation.

Troubleshooting & Support

What should I do if a scan fails? +

Ensure your browser tab remains active during the scan. If you encounter an error, check your Google Cloud Console for any API quota restrictions.

Why is my Google API Key being rejected? +

Ensure that you have correctly added the specific origin URL of Drive-Guard to the 'Authorized JavaScript origins' list in your Google Cloud Console.

Why am I seeing a 'Quota Exceeded' error? +

This means your Google Workspace has hit its daily API limit. You can request a quota increase directly from your Google Cloud Console.
